John Mulaney Shuts Down the Emmys 2026 With Must-See Monologue

He read from a borrowed self-help book and was bleeped for a DJ Khaled joke before announcing Noah Wyle as the winner.

  • On Monday, comedian John Mulaney presented the Outstanding Lead Actor in a Drama Series award at the 78th Primetime Emmy Awards in Los Angeles, delivering a widely discussed monologue that drew sustained laughter from the crowd.
  • Mulaney jokingly claimed men have been "historically unrepresented" on television, describing the nominees as "a crop of prom kings" who are "not soft like the dad on 'Bluey."
  • References included DJ Khaled's 2018 comments about oral sex, which resulted in broadcast censorship, and an excerpt from actor Frank Vincent's 2007 book on manhood.
  • Following the broadcast, social media users praised Mulaney's performance, with many arguing his comedic presentation proved he should host the Emmy Awards ceremony next year.
  • Noah Wyle secured the Outstanding Lead Actor award for his role in The Pitt on HBO, concluding the segment after Mulaney's monologue drew sustained applause at the Peacock Theatre.
